The Four Tasks a Receptionist Robot Handles
A receptionist robot handles the four tasks a front desk repeats all day. It greets an arriving visitor, runs them through check-in, notifies the host, and points them at the meeting room or the lift. Most models add a printed badge by driving a separate badge printer, because a robot cannot hold a print mechanism of its own and stay mobile.
The check-in itself runs in software. The robot is a body wrapped around it. A robot for reception connects to the same visitor-management system a kiosk would use. That system holds the visitor record, the host notification, the non-disclosure agreement and the badge template. Choosing a robot does not change it, so confirm the integration exists before anything else. A robot that cannot write into your visitor log gets typed up by hand afterwards, which adds work rather than removing it.
Movement and presence are the genuinely robotic part. The machine turns toward someone crossing the lobby, escorts a visitor to the lift, and holds a face-to-face conversation with someone who never touches a screen. That matters for visitors who cannot use a touchscreen and for buildings where a tablet looks wrong.
The Machines Sold into Lobbies
Three families of machine get sold for reception work, and they sit at different price points. UBTECH Robotics builds the Cruzr line, a wheeled humanoid about 1.2 m tall with a chest touchscreen, sold for lobbies and government service halls. The current model is the Cruzr S2. PAL Robotics sells ARI, a social robot aimed at concierge, guidance and telepresence work in public buildings. Temi sits at the cheaper end as a screen on a self-driving base rather than a humanoid.
Published prices are scarce, so use reseller listings and treat them as a starting figure. RobotLAB, a US reseller, lists the UBTECH Cruzr at $35,000 to buy, with a robot-as-a-service option starting around $1,000 a month. That subscription route matters more than the sticker price for most buyers. It turns a capital request into an operating cost, and it includes support for a machine your facilities team cannot repair.
Pepper is the model buyers ask about most, and it is no longer a live option. Current alternatives are compared in the humanoid robots for business guide. SoftBank Robotics ended new Pepper production in 2021, so a Pepper in a lobby today is used hardware with no manufacturer warranty behind it. Buy a current platform instead, or accept that spares come from the secondary market.

The Kiosk Is the Real Competitor
For most lobbies the choice is not between two robots. It is between a robot and a tablet on a stand running visitor-management software, and the tablet wins on arithmetic almost every time. Envoy publishes its pricing as a free tier capped at 100 visitors a month plus paid tiers charged per location per month. Most of this market is priced the same way.
Run the comparison over three years and it stops being close. A $35,000 robot plus support sits against a few hundred dollars a month for software and a tablet. The kiosk completes the same check-in, prints the same badge and notifies the same host. The robot adds conversation, movement and presence, so ask whether those three are worth roughly three times the three-year cost in your building.
Buy the kiosk if your lobby is quiet, your visitors are repeat contractors and suppliers, and check-in is a name, a host and a badge. Buy the robot if the lobby is the product. Showrooms, flagship offices, museums and hotel foyers all sell an impression, and a machine people stop to talk to earns its keep in a way a stand does not. Where Receptionist Robots Break
Accents and background noise cause most of the failures. Speech recognition degrades as a room gets louder, and a lobby with a coffee machine, a revolving door and hard floors is loud all day. Regional accents and second-language speakers push the error rate higher again. Specify a touchscreen path through every task, so a visitor the robot cannot hear finishes check-in by tapping.
Two people arriving at once is the failure nobody demonstrates. A robot has one screen, one microphone array and one conversation, so the second visitor waits. A bank of tablets scales by adding a tablet. If your arrivals cluster around meeting start times, count how many people reach the desk in the same minute before buying a single machine.
Escalation is the third weak point, and it decides whether visitors trust the machine. Every robot needs a fast route to a person when it cannot resolve something. That means a video call to a shared reception team, a button that rings a staff phone, or a member of staff within sight. ARI and the Cruzr line include telepresence for exactly this, letting a remote receptionist appear on the screen. Without that route, a stuck visitor stands in your lobby with nobody to ask.

After-Hours and Multi-Site Coverage
The strongest case for a robot for reception is a building open longer than its front desk is staffed, which is why the pattern shows up first in hotel lobbies. Telepresence lets one remote receptionist cover several sites, appearing on whichever machine has a visitor in front of it. That turns three part-time desks into one full-time post covering all three.
A kiosk covers the same hours, so be precise about what the robot adds. It adds a face, a voice and the ability to move toward someone standing lost in the middle of the lobby. Where deliveries, contractors and unfamiliar visitors arrive outside desk hours, that difference is worth measuring rather than assuming.
Measure it as you would any front-of-house change. Log a fortnight of after-hours arrivals, note how many needed something a kiosk cannot do, and price the robot against that count. If the answer is two visitors a week, buy the kiosk and put a phone beside it.
Who Should Not Buy a Receptionist Robot
Small offices with predictable visitors should not buy one. If your arrivals are a courier, a cleaner and one scheduled meeting a day, a tablet running visitor-management software solves the whole problem. Spend the difference on door access and a decent badge printer. Buildings with steps between the entrance and the lift should also skip it, because a wheeled base cannot follow a visitor it cannot reach.
Regulated reception desks are the other exclusion. Where check-in involves verifying an identity document, taking a signature that carries legal weight, or handling health information, keep a person in the loop. A robot can collect the details and hand the case to staff, and that handover has to be designed rather than assumed.
Two changes would shift this verdict. Speech recognition that holds up at lobby noise levels across strong accents would remove the failure visitors resent most. Prices falling to roughly what a staffed desk costs for a few months would make the robot a cheap trial rather than a capital decision. At today's listed figures it is not.
Bottom Line
Four situations justify a receptionist robot. A busy lobby, a multilingual visitor base, hours the desk is not staffed, or a front of house that forms part of the sales pitch. Outside those, a tablet kiosk does the same job for roughly a third of the three-year cost. Count a fortnight of arrivals at your own desk, note how many needed conversation rather than a form, and shortlist receptionist robots only if that number justifies the gap.

Can a receptionist robot print visitor badges?
Yes, by driving a separate badge printer through your visitor-management software. The robot does not carry a print mechanism. Confirm that the printer and the software you already use are supported before ordering, because an unsupported combination means the badge gets printed by a person.

Do receptionist robots handle two visitors at once?
No. One screen, one microphone array and one conversation means the second person waits. A bank of tablets scales by adding a tablet, so buildings with visitors arriving in clusters at meeting times should count simultaneous arrivals before choosing a single machine.
Can you buy a new Pepper robot for reception?
No. SoftBank Robotics ended Pepper production in 2021, so units in lobbies today are second-hand and out of manufacturer warranty. Buy a current platform such as the Cruzr line or Temi if you want support and spares.
